Blame doc/functions/gnutls_kx_get

Packit Service 4684c1
Packit Service 4684c1
Packit Service 4684c1
Packit Service 4684c1
Packit Service 4684c1
@deftypefun {gnutls_kx_algorithm_t} {gnutls_kx_get} (gnutls_session_t @var{session})
Packit Service 4684c1
@var{session}: is a @code{gnutls_session_t}  type.
Packit Service 4684c1
Packit Service 4684c1
Get the currently used key exchange algorithm.
Packit Service 4684c1
Packit Service 4684c1
This function will return @code{GNUTLS_KX_ECDHE_RSA} , or @code{GNUTLS_KX_DHE_RSA} 
Packit Service 4684c1
under TLS 1.3, to indicate an elliptic curve DH key exchange or
Packit Service 4684c1
a finite field one. The precise group used is available
Packit Service 4684c1
by calling @code{gnutls_group_get()}  instead.
Packit Service 4684c1
Packit Service 4684c1
@strong{Returns:} the key exchange algorithm used in the last handshake, a
Packit Service 4684c1
@code{gnutls_kx_algorithm_t}  value.
Packit Service 4684c1
@end deftypefun